WitrynaCancer is a significant cause of ill-health and death, both at home and in the workplace. Nearly 2 million people are diagnosed with cancer in the US each year and it is estimated that there are currently just over 3.3 million people of working age living with a cancer diagnosis. Work is extremely important to people living with cancer.
